Jobs for Electromechanical Technology Grads in South Carolina

In this state, there are 610 people employed in jobs related to an Electromechanical Technology/Electromechanical Engineering Technology degree, compared to 34,700 nationwide.

Wages for Electromechanical Technology Jobs in South Carolina

In this state, Electromechanical Technology/Electromechanical Engineering Technology grads earn an average of $68,714. Nationwide, they make an average of $77,008.
